Coventry University is a forward-looking, modern university with a proud tradition as a provider of high quality education and a focus on applied research. Students benefit from state-of-the-art equipment and facilities in all academic disciplines including health, design and engineering laboratories, and performing arts studios and computing centres. 

 

Students with international experience obtain higher starting salaries, develop the global skills employers require and achieve better career progression. The dedicated Centre for Global Engagement (CGE) offers a range of programmes and funding to assist students in widening their international experience including language classes, studying or working abroad, international fieldtrips, global research, cultural workshops, Summer Schools, leadership development or work experience in the UK. 

 

 

 

Why Coventry University 

 

  • Employability: Coventry University focus on increasing the employability of students and have a range of industry-leading initiatives to help prepare you for graduate employment. The Talent Team can help you to find work experience, join international field trips or study towards industry qualifications. And, unlike many universities, if you choose to undertake an optional work placement or study abroad year, you won’t be charged a tuition fee.
  • Teaching: Coventry courses are dynamic, interactive and stimulating, designed to bring your subject to life.
  • Location: Coventry is a vibrant and diverse student city, located in the centre of the UK and only 1 hour from London by train. The single-site campus is located at the heart of Coventry, so everything you need is within a few minutes’ walk. The city’s rich history and heritage sees world famous sites like Coventry Cathedral and St Mary’s Guildhall sit alongside exciting newer developments like Coventry Transport Museum, Fargo Village and a host of shops, restaurants, entertainment and nightlife venues. 
  • Student Experience: Awarded University of the Year for Student Experience 2019, the reputation of student experience at Coventry is based on a solid foundation of academic and welfare student support. There is a great Students’ Union too, with more than 55 sports clubs and 160 societies, so it is easy to spend time doing the things you enjoy.  
  • Top 15 UK University for 5 Years Running (The Guardian University Guide, 2016-2020) 
  • The University of Year for Student Experience (The Times & Sunday Times Good University Guide, 2019)
  • Awarded 5 stars or teaching, employability, facilities, internationalisation and inclusiveness (QS Stars Rating System, 2019)
  • Awarded Gold for outstanding Teaching and Learning (Teaching Excellence Framework)

Program Description

Architecture remains one of the most enjoyable and rewarding professions; in designing new spaces and buildings around our everyday lives and needs, you will be challenged intellectually, artistically and creatively.
You can make a major positive contribution to society by shaping our environment and surroundings, leaving a lasting impact and legacy.
 
Professionally accredited by the Royal Institute of British Architects (RIBA), this course adopts a hands-on approach to learning with a focus on imagination, communication and context. We run skills sessions to support drawing and model making as an integral part of studio work. You will also have access to excellent workshops in the Graham Sutherland Building, run by specialists in the areas of woodworking, clay modelling and digital craft processes.
 
Coventry is ranked as the 5th best university in the country for Architecture in the Guardian University Guide 2020, and our graduates are highly regarded in the profession. They can be found working in leading architectural practices, including Aedas RHWL, Faulkner Browns Architects, C.F. Møller Architects and Schmidt Hammer Lassen.
